Perpendicular LinesIf angle between two intersecting lines is 90° (right angle) Then they are perpendicular So, XY is perpendicular to AB ∴ XY ⊥ AB Real life examples of perpendicular lines are To make perpendicular lines, we can use a set square and a ruler Can you try making?
